PER DIEM RATES FOR TRACE-P SITES
Per Diem Rates (all in US dollars):
Integration/Offload Sites:
Wallops Flight Facility, VA (Accomack County): $69/night lodging and $34/day meals
Edwards AFB, Lancaster, and Palmdale, CA (the latter two are in Los Angeles County): $99/night lodging and $46/day meals
Rosamond and Mojave (Kern County), CA: $68/night lodging and $38/day meals
These rates are effective as of October 1, 2000 and are exclusive of tax. These rates will be in effect throughout TRACE-P. However, travelers may verify these rates themselves at the following web site: http://www.gsa.gov/Portal/gsa/ep/channelView.do?pageTypeId=8203&channelId=-15943
Transit Sites:
Kona, HI (Island of Hawaii, Other): $89/night lodging and $54/day meals
Wake Island: $60/night lodging and $32/day meals
Guam: $150/night lodging and $71/day meals
Midway Islands: $150/night lodging and $47/day meals
These rates are current as of November 1, 2000 and are exclusive of tax. These rates are subject to change monthly.
Intensive Sites:
Hong Kong: $180/night lodging and $115/day meals
Yokota Air Base, Japan: $104/night lodging and $57/day meals
These rates are current as of November 1, 2000 and are inclusive of taxes. These rates are reviewed monthly and are thus subject to change. Travelers can monitor these rates for updates at the following web site: http://www.state.gov/m/a/als/prdm/
